Tunisia thwarts irregular migration attempts into Europe

Tunisia said, on Sunday, it foiled 52 irregular immigration attempts to cross the Mediterranean into Europe, Anadolu Agency reports.

In a statement, the Tunisian Interior Ministry said it arrested 1,004 people during a security operation between Sept. 27 and Sept. 29 in the southern province of Sfax.

According to the statement, the ministry officials rounded up 216 Tunisians, 667 migrants from sub-Saharan Africa and 73 people from other nationalities.

Sfax is the main route for illegal migrants to cross from Tunisia into Europe.

For years, North African countries such as Tunisia, Algeria, Libya, Mauritania and Morocco have witnessed attempts by migrants to reach Europe.

The migrants are mainly from sub-Saharan Africa.

According to Tunisian authorities, over 37,000 irregular migrants had been arrested in 2022. (middleeastmonitor.com)
